Hijackers shoot two officers and police dog

A suspect has been fatally shot, while two officers, a police dog and a second suspect were wounded in a shootout in Ntuzuma, KwaZulu-Natal, today.

A vehicle was allegedly hijacked, and police pursued the armed suspects, Phoenix Sun reported.

KZN VIP spokesperson Romano Naidoo said there was an exchange of gunfire, where two officers were hit, and a suspect sustained a fatal gunshot wound.

The officers are in a stable condition, while the police dog from the Dog Unit is believed to be in a critical condition. The condition of the injured suspect is unknown.

“KZN VIP response units, together with police, stood down at the scene. The suspects continued to fire at personnel on the scene before fleeing. The injured were stabilised on the scene before being rushed to hospital for further treatment,” said Naidoo.

Two suspects remain at large.

Last week, a former police officer shot and killed during a robbery at his home in Linden, Johannesburg.

Andre Fabricius and his family were allegedly attacked by three men armed with a gun and axes.

Fabricius was reportedly shot in the heart while his wife and 13-year-old son were tied up in the house.
